많은 경우, 데이터나 텍스트에서 하이픈을 제거하는 것이 필요할 수 있습니다. 이 글에서는 하이픈 제거 자동화하는 법에 대해 알아보고, 실무에서 유용한 예시와 팁을 제공하겠습니다.
하이픈 제거의 필요성
하이픈은 때때로 텍스트 가독성을 떨어뜨리거나 데이터 처리에 불필요한 요소가 될 수 있습니다. 예를 들어, URL이나 파일 이름에서 하이픈이 포함되어 있을 경우, 검색 엔진 최적화(SEO)에 부정적인 영향을 미칠 수 있습니다. 따라서 하이픈을 제거하는 자동화 과정이 필요합니다.
하이픈 제거 자동화 방법
하이픈을 제거하는 방법은 여러 가지가 있습니다. 대표적인 방법으로는 다음과 같은 프로그래밍 언어를 활용한 스크립트 작성이 있습니다:
1. Python을 이용한 하이픈 제거
Python은 텍스트 처리를 위한 강력한 도구입니다. 다음은 Python을 사용하여 하이픈을 제거하는 간단한 코드입니다.
text = "하이픈-제거-예시"
cleaned_text = text.replace("-", "")
print(cleaned_text) # 하이픈제거예시
2. Excel을 이용한 하이픈 제거
Excel에서도 하이픈을 쉽게 제거할 수 있습니다. 다음은 Excel에서 하이픈을 제거하는 방법입니다.
단계 | 설명 |
---|---|
1 | 하이픈이 포함된 데이터를 선택합니다. |
2 | Ctrl + H를 눌러 "찾기 및 바꾸기" 창을 엽니다. |
3 | 찾을 내용에 하이픈(-)을 입력하고, 바꿀 내용은 비워둡니다. |
4 | 모두 바꾸기를 클릭하여 하이픈을 제거합니다. |
3. Google Sheets를 이용한 하이픈 제거
Google Sheets에서도 간단하게 하이픈을 제거할 수 있습니다. 다음은 Google Sheets에서 하이픈을 제거하는 방법입니다.
단계 | 설명 |
---|---|
1 | 하이픈이 포함된 셀을 선택합니다. |
2 | 함수 입력란에 =SUBSTITUTE(A1, "-", "")를 입력합니다. |
3 | Enter 키를 눌러 하이픈이 제거된 결과를 확인합니다. |
실용적인 팁
1. 정기적인 데이터 정리: 하이픈 제거는 정기적으로 수행하는 것이 좋습니다. 데이터베이스의 일관성을 유지하기 위해 매주 또는 매달 데이터를 점검하고 하이픈을 제거하는 과정을 포함하세요. 이를 통해 데이터의 가독성을 높일 수 있습니다.
2. 자동화 도구 활용: 다양한 자동화 도구(예: Zapier, Integromat)를 활용하여 하이픈 제거 작업을 자동화할 수 있습니다. 예를 들어, 특정 조건을 만족하는 경우 하이픈을 제거한 후 다른 애플리케이션으로 전송하는 작업을 설정할 수 있습니다.
3. 텍스트 전처리 라이브러리 사용: Python의 NLTK나 SpaCy와 같은 텍스트 전처리 라이브러리를 사용하면 하이픈 제거뿐만 아니라 다양한 텍스트 정제 작업을 자동화할 수 있습니다. 이를 통해 데이터 분석의 효율성을 높일 수 있습니다.
4. 매크로 사용: Excel에서 매크로를 사용하여 반복적인 하이픈 제거 작업을 자동화할 수 있습니다. 매크로를 기록하고 나중에 실행함으로써 시간을 절약하고 오류를 줄일 수 있습니다.
5. 사용자 정의 함수 작성: Google Sheets에서는 사용자 정의 함수를 작성하여 하이픈 제거 작업을 편리하게 수행할 수 있습니다. 이를 통해 특정 셀 범위에 대해 하이픈을 한번에 제거할 수 있는 기능을 추가할 수 있습니다.
요약 및 실천 가능한 정리
하이픈 제거 자동화는 데이터 가독성을 높이기 위한 중요한 작업입니다. Python, Excel, Google Sheets 등 다양한 도구를 활용하여 하이픈을 쉽게 제거할 수 있습니다. 정기적인 데이터 점검, 자동화 도구 활용, 텍스트 전처리 라이브러리 사용, 매크로 및 사용자 정의 함수 작성 등의 팁을 통해 더욱 효율적으로 작업을 수행할 수 있습니다. 하이픈 제거 작업을 통해 데이터의 일관성과 신뢰성을 높이고, SEO에도 긍정적인 효과를 누리세요.